How Dogs Help Reduce Anxiety and Depression

Dogs are more than cute companions—they’re often emotional lifelines for many people. Their presence can calm a racing mind, ease feelings of loneliness, and offer a sense of routine that’s comforting. Whether it’s a wagging tail after a long day or a quiet moment of cuddling, dogs can have a serious positive impact on mental health, especially when it comes to anxiety and depression. Unconditional Love and Companionship One of the biggest benefits of having a dog is the constant companionship they offer. Dogs don’t judge, they don’t expect you to always be cheerful, and they stay by your side no matter what. That kind of loyalty creates a strong emotional bond that can be deeply healing, especially for people going through hard times. Encouraging Routine and Responsibility Caring for a dog means sticking to a schedule—feeding them, walking them, playing with them.
